Output cafc5f2646f1187d00730cda21fc1b12ea1e38c156628434006c64219c9ab914:0

value
24563
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e9d64a32425f078a94ab2d9923d5aba4c1fa972 OP_EQUAL
address
3Eh6RebQh3JW8ghf4xhrEpkZtcsf3gFTuD
transaction
cafc5f2646f1187d00730cda21fc1b12ea1e38c156628434006c64219c9ab914